Kendal Grey already has a clear picture of the kind of WrestleMania stage she wants to reach.

While speaking on the Mark Hoke Show, Grey was asked which WWE names she could picture standing across from her in a future WrestleMania main event. She named Rhea Ripley, Sol Ruca and Roxanne Perez as three opponents she would love to meet in that setting.

Grey said Ripley was an immediate choice, then pointed to Sol Ruca as someone she wants to face one-on-one after sharing tag matches with her. She also praised Perez, noting that the two are around the same age and saying she believes they could put together a strong match.

What Grey's WrestleMania list says about her NXT ambitions

Kendal Grey naming Rhea Ripley, Sol Ruca and Roxanne Perez puts her focus squarely on the highest level of WWE's women's division, and it shows how quickly she is thinking beyond simply settling into NXT.

Ripley represents the established main-event standard, while Sol Ruca and Perez are opponents Grey can realistically cross paths with sooner as her in-ring role grows. With WrestleMania 42's main event fallout still unfolding, Grey using that stage as her reference point is another sign that she sees herself chasing a much bigger spot than a developmental roster role.

The Sol Ruca mention also stands out because Grey tied it to matches they have already had in tag action. That gives her comments a little more weight than a random dream match list, because she singled out a pairing she believes could translate into a notable singles program if WWE decides to move in that direction.
